About Liz Cheney
Liz Cheney is an attorney and specialist in U.S. Middle East Policy. From 2005-2006, she was the Principal Deputy Assistant Secretary of State for Near Eastern Affairs. In this capacity, she was the second-ranking State Department official responsible U.S. policy in the Middle East. Prior to that, Ms. Cheney served as the Deputy Assistant Secretary of State for Near Easter Affairs from 2002 to 2004. She was responsible for the establishment of the $300 million Middle East Partnership Initiative to support political, economic, and educational reform and the empowerment of women in the Middle East. Ms. Cheney practiced law at White and Case LLP in the area of international project finance from 1996 to 1999. From 1999 to 2002 she served on assignment with the International Finance Corporation, a member of the World Bank Group. Ms. Cheney served previously at the Department of State and at the Agency for International Development from 1989 to 1993 designing and managing US assistance projects in Eastern Europe and the former Soviet Union. She is currently collaborating with Vice President Cheney on his memoirs, covering 40 years of his career in Washington. She is Chairman of the board of KeepAmericaSafe.com, a non-profit organization dedicated to education and advocacy about American national security policy. She also chairs the board of the Institute for the Study of War and is a member of the International Board of Visitors at the University of Wyoming. Ms. Cheney earned her law degree from the University of Chicago in 1996 and her bachelor’s degree from the Colorado College in 1988. She is married to Phillip J. Perry and they have five children.
